PUBLIC SAFETY OFFICER – FULL-TIMEPerforms public safety duties involving the protection of life and property and the enforcement of applicable City ordinances and State laws. Depending on certification, responsibilities may include law enforcement patrol, emergency response, emergency medical services, public assistance and other duties within the Department of Public Safety.The employee must maintain the appropriate State of Florida certification and participate in required training and continuing education. All emergency medical services are provided in accordance with applicable Volusia County EMS protocols and medical direction. Work requires regular interaction with the public and an emphasis on professional service and positive community relations.This position requires rotating shifts, including nights, weekends and holidays, and may be subject to call while off duty.
